C# Class NVelocity.Runtime.Parser.Node.ASTSubtractNode

Handles integer subtraction of nodes (in #set() ) * Please look at the Parser.jjt file which is what controls the generation of this class. *
Inheritance: NVelocity.Runtime.Parser.Node.SimpleNode
Exibir arquivo Open project: nats/castle-1.0.3-mono Class Usage Examples

Public Methods

Method Description
ASTSubtractNode ( Parser p, int id ) : System
ASTSubtractNode ( int id ) : System
Accept ( IParserVisitor visitor, Object data ) : Object

Accept the visitor.

Value ( IInternalContextAdapter context ) : Object

Computes the value of the subtraction. Currently limited to integers.

Method Details

ASTSubtractNode() public method

public ASTSubtractNode ( Parser p, int id ) : System
p Parser
id int
return System

ASTSubtractNode() public method

public ASTSubtractNode ( int id ) : System
id int
return System

Accept() public method

Accept the visitor.
public Accept ( IParserVisitor visitor, Object data ) : Object
visitor IParserVisitor
data Object
return Object

Value() public method

Computes the value of the subtraction. Currently limited to integers.
public Value ( IInternalContextAdapter context ) : Object
context IInternalContextAdapter
return Object